31 lines
589 B
Java
31 lines
589 B
Java
import java.util.ArrayList;
|
|
|
|
public class Votes {
|
|
|
|
private String competitor;
|
|
private ArrayList<Vote> voters;
|
|
|
|
public Votes(String competitor, ArrayList<Vote> voters) {
|
|
this.competitor = competitor;
|
|
this.voters = voters;
|
|
}
|
|
|
|
public String getCompetitorName() {
|
|
return this.competitor;
|
|
}
|
|
|
|
public ArrayList<Vote> getVoters() {
|
|
return this.voters;
|
|
}
|
|
|
|
public int getTotalPoints() {
|
|
int sum = 0;
|
|
|
|
for(Vote vote : this.voters) {
|
|
sum += vote.getPoints();
|
|
}
|
|
|
|
return sum;
|
|
}
|
|
}
|